The slogan "Jai Jawan Jai Kisan" was given by Lal Bahadur Shastri. Therefore, the correct answer is: This slogan, meaning "Hail the soldier, Hail the farmer," was popularized by Shastri during his tenure as Prime Minister of India, emphasizing the importance of soldiers and farmers to the nation's security and self-sufficiency.
